Successful Strategies for Bid Protests and Debriefings
A bid protest is a challenge to the terms of a solicitation or the award of a contract by a federal government agency. A contractor who chooses to contest the award of a federal government contract can file a bid protest in any of three different forums: (1) at the procuring agency, (2) at the Government Accountability Office (GAO), or (3) at the U.S. Court of Federal Claims (COFC). This class will provide an overview of the bid protest process and discuss the costs and benefits associated with each of the three different forums. It will also outline strategies that contractors can use to navigate the bid protest process and position themselves for success.
